Senior Counsel Charles Kanjama has urged the Independent Electoral and Boundaries Commission (IEBC) selection panel to actively engage politicians in the ongoing reconstitution process, warning that sidelining key stakeholders could fuel claims of bias and erode trust in the electoral body.
Speaking on Spice FM, Kanjama noted that ignoring concerns raised by politicians-who will ultimately compete in elections officiated by the IEBC-risks deepening suspicions around an institution that has presided over multiple disputed contests.
